Why EMDR for Addiction?  

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R) is a trauma-informed therapy that helps the brain reprocess distressing memories and emotional triggers. When applied to addiction, EMDR can reduce cravings, address shame, and dismantle the emotional drivers behind substance use or compulsive behaviors.

What to Expect in an Intensive Session:

  Extended one-on-one sessions (typically 3–6 hours) for deep, uninterrupted therapeutic work

  A personalized treatment plan focused on your addiction history, emotional triggers, and recovery goals

  Targeting of specific memories or experiences that fuel addictive patterns

  Integration of coping strategies and relapse prevention tools to support long-term healing
